Abstract(in English) Recently, a 400-Gb/s-based transmission system is especially focused on as a promising candidate of the next generation transmission system. There are several approaches to realize 400-Gb/s signals in combination with baud-rate, modulation format and number of subcarriers. Especially, dual-carrier PDM-16QAM signal is focused on metro networks which are rapidly increasing data traffic demand. In addition, since wavelength selective switches (WSSs) in reconfigurable optical add/drop multiplexers (ROADM) are connected in multiple stages on metro networks, the cascaded filtering effects which occur in ROADMs is a serious concern. Therefore, we experimentally investigate filtering tolerance of 400-Gb/s signal (DC-PDM-16QAM signals) in 75-GHz-grid ROADM networks considering.
